Etymology[edit]

From German Pfosten. Doublet of posteno and poŝto.

Noun[edit]

fosto (accusative singular foston, plural fostoj, accusative plural fostojn)

  1. post, stanchion
  2. stake (piece of timber where martyrs are placed to be burned)
